Treehoppers (more precisely typical treehoppers to distinguish them from the Aetalionidae) and thorn bugs are members of the family Membracidae, a group of insects related to the cicadas and the leafhoppers.About 3,200 species of treehoppers in over 400 genera are known. Cappaert, Bugwood.org) The Japanese beetle is an exotic and potentially invasive pest for which the California Department of Food and Agriculture (CDFA) is conducting eradication efforts to limit its spread outside the current trapping and treatment area. If your space is Southern California yellowjackets are black and yellow (one species, V. consobrina is black and white but is found north of the LA basin) and typically are rather smooth (not hairy) in appearance.Some people think that they are bees because they have stocky bodies like honey bees.
